快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
开发一个快速启动模板项目,预配置了清华源镜像。要求:1. 支持Python/Node.js/Java三种技术栈可选;2. 包含常用开发依赖的预配置;3. 一键初始化脚本;4. 集成VS Code开发容器配置。模板应展示如何在不同技术栈中利用清华源加速依赖安装,并提供简单的Hello World示例验证环境是否正常工作。- 点击'项目生成'按钮,等待项目生成完整后预览效果
作为一个经常需要快速验证想法的开发者,我深刻体会到环境配置这个"脏活"有多浪费时间。最近发现用清华源镜像配合一些自动化工具,能把原型开发的启动时间压缩到5分钟以内,分享下我的实践心得。
为什么需要快速原型环境? 当灵感来临时,最怕的就是被环境配置打断思路。传统方式需要手动安装依赖、配置镜像源、搭建基础框架,可能半小时就过去了。而预配置好的模板能让我们直接聚焦核心逻辑开发。
三技术栈统一配置方案 我设计的模板同时支持Python、Node.js和Java三种主流技术栈,核心思路是通过统一的镜像源配置实现加速:
- Python:在pip.conf中预设清华pypi源
- Node.js:通过.npmrc文件配置镜像地址
Java:在Maven的settings.xml里设置镜像仓库
一键初始化魔法 模板包含一个智能初始化脚本,能自动完成:
- 根据项目类型识别技术栈
- 创建对应的配置文件
- 安装基础依赖包
生成Hello World示例代码
开发容器集成 通过VS Code的devcontainer.json配置,可以实现:
- 开箱即用的开发环境
- 预装各语言的核心工具链
- 自动挂载镜像源配置
- 统一的开发体验
- 验证流程示例 以Python项目为例:
- 运行初始化脚本选择Python模板
- 自动创建虚拟环境并配置pip源
- 安装requests等常用库
执行示例脚本验证网络请求
实际效果对比
- 传统方式:手动配置约15-20分钟
- 使用模板:平均3分钟完成
依赖下载速度提升5-8倍
进阶优化建议
- 添加多镜像源自动切换
- 支持自定义依赖包选择
- 集成测试框架配置
- 增加Docker生产环境配置
最近在InsCode(快马)平台上实践这个方案特别顺畅,它的云端开发环境天然适合快速原型设计。不需要配置本地环境,打开网页就能直接开干,内置的AI辅助还能帮忙生成基础代码。最惊艳的是部署功能,原型验证完点个按钮就能生成可分享的演示链接,省去了搭建测试服务器的麻烦。对于需要快速验证创意的场景,这种全流程的便捷体验确实能大幅提升效率。
快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
开发一个快速启动模板项目,预配置了清华源镜像。要求:1. 支持Python/Node.js/Java三种技术栈可选;2. 包含常用开发依赖的预配置;3. 一键初始化脚本;4. 集成VS Code开发容器配置。模板应展示如何在不同技术栈中利用清华源加速依赖安装,并提供简单的Hello World示例验证环境是否正常工作。- 点击'项目生成'按钮,等待项目生成完整后预览效果